Iran: The so-called "unprecedented" sanctions imposed by the United States have no impact on Iran's stance
2026-08-17 16:33:50
According to CoinMeta, as reported by Yonhap News Agency ( IRNA ), a spokesman for Iran's Ministry of Foreign Affairs stated in response to the U.S. government's announcement of unprecedented sanctions against Iran, including a land blockade: "These measures will have no impact on Iran's stance. Whether it is this war or over the past 50 years, the United States has trapped itself in a vicious cycle of war, discrimination, pressure, and sanctions. If you remember, during the Democratic administration, the concept of so-called 'paralyzing sanctions' was proposed, and later during Trump's first term, the 'maximum pressure' campaign was launched. All these prove the anti-human nature of the Americans; they cut off our people's access to medicines, used every means to pressure Iran, and ultimately resorted to illegal military aggression, and we are still suffering the consequences to this day. Please rest assured that using these old methods that have already been tried and proven ineffective will not yield new results. Without a doubt, not only now, but long ago as well, we have made necessary preparations based on assessments of various scenarios in which the United States might continue to harm Iran in various ways. Iran will surely use all its means to respond to the new situation."
